Introduction to Kombucha and Digestion
Kombucha’s potential to aid in digestion is primarily attributed to its probiotic content. Probiotics are live microorganisms that confer health benefits when administered in adequate amounts. The fermentation process of kombucha creates a rich blend of probiotics, which can help maintain a healthy gut microbiome. A healthy gut microbiome is essential for proper digestion, as it aids in the breakdown and absorption of nutrients from food. Moreover, the probiotics in kombucha may help alleviate symptoms of digestive disorders, such as irritable bowel syndrome (IBS), by regulating bowel movements and reducing inflammation.
Probiotic Content and Strains
The probiotic content in kombucha can vary depending on the fermentation time, tea type, and sugar content. However, most kombucha brews contain strains such as Bacillus coagulans, Lactobacillus, and Bifidobacterium, which are known for their digestive health benefits. These strains can help in the production of vitamins, such as vitamin K and biotin, and can also aid in the digestion of lactose, making kombucha a potential beverage for those with lactose intolerance.
Probiotic Strain | Benefits |
---|---|
Bacillus coagulans | Enhances immune system, aids in lactose digestion |
Lactobacillus | Supports gut health, helps in vitamin production |
Bifidobacterium | Essential for gut microbiota, improves digestion and immune response |
Fermentation Process and Digestive Health
The fermentation process of kombucha is crucial for its digestive health benefits. The longer fermentation time can lead to a higher concentration of probiotics and a lower pH level, making the drink more acidic. This acidity can help in reducing the growth of harmful bacteria in the gut, thereby promoting a balanced gut microbiome. Furthermore, the fermentation process breaks down some of the sugars present in the tea, resulting in a drink that is lower in calories and richer in beneficial compounds.
Acidity and pH Levels
The acidity of kombucha, measured by its pH level, can range from 2.5 to 3.5, depending on the fermentation time. This acidity is beneficial for digestive health as it can help in stimulating digestive enzymes and improving nutrient absorption. However, it’s essential to note that excessive consumption of acidic beverages can lead to tooth erosion and other dental issues, emphasizing the need for moderate consumption and good oral hygiene practices.

Is homemade kombucha safer than store-bought?
+Both homemade and store-bought kombucha can be safe if properly brewed and stored. Homemade kombucha allows for control over ingredients and fermentation conditions, which can be beneficial for those with specific dietary needs. However, store-bought kombucha is regulated and must meet certain safety standards, reducing the risk of contamination. Always choose products from reputable manufacturers and follow safe brewing practices if making kombucha at home.
